About N-(4-chloro-2-methylphenyl)-1,3,6-trimethylpyrazolo[3,4-b]pyridine-4-carboxamide
N-(4-chloro-2-methylphenyl)-1,3,6-trimethylpyrazolo[3,4-b]pyridine-4-carboxamide (PubChem CID 16609333) has the molecular formula C17H17ClN4O
and a molecular weight of 328.80 g/mol. Its IUPAC name is N-(4-chloro-2-methylphenyl)-1,3,6-trimethylpyrazolo[3,4-b]pyridine-4-carboxamide.

What is the SMILES notation for N-(4-chloro-2-methylphenyl)-1,3,6-trimethylpyrazolo[3,4-b]pyridine-4-carboxamide?
The canonical SMILES for N-(4-chloro-2-methylphenyl)-1,3,6-trimethylpyrazolo[3,4-b]pyridine-4-carboxamide is Cc1cc(C(=O)Nc2ccc(Cl)cc2C)c2c(C)nn(C)c2n1.
What is the InChIKey of N-(4-chloro-2-methylphenyl)-1,3,6-trimethylpyrazolo[3,4-b]pyridine-4-carboxamide?
The InChIKey is ALPSCJNRVBAFFE-UHFFFAOYSA-N. The full InChI is InChI=1S/C17H17ClN4O/c1-9-7-12(18)5-6-14(9)20-17(23)13-8-10(2)19-16-15(13)11(3)21-22(16)4/h5-8H,1-4H3,(H,20,23).
What are the key properties of N-(4-chloro-2-methylphenyl)-1,3,6-trimethylpyrazolo[3,4-b]pyridine-4-carboxamide?
N-(4-chloro-2-methylphenyl)-1,3,6-trimethylpyrazolo[3,4-b]pyridine-4-carboxamide has a molecular weight of 328.80 g/mol, XLogP of 3.80, 2 rotatable bonds, 1 hydrogen bond donors, and 4 hydrogen bond acceptors.
